Questions & Answers

What companies run services between Pagani, Campania, Italy and Mercato San Severino, Italy?

Trenitalia operates a train from Nocera Inferiore to Mercato S. Severino every 4 hours. Tickets cost €1–3 and the journey takes 22 min. Alternatively, you can take a bus from Pagani - Piazza Sant'Alfonso to Mercato San Severino - Capolinea via Salerno - Lugomare Trieste and Salerno - Piazza XXIV Maggio in around 1h 55m.
